A Certified Kingdom Advisor® demonstrates:
- The ability to apply biblical wisdom in financial counsel.
- Technical competence through other professional designation(s)
- Ethical practice through active local church involvement
- Biblical stewardship by pledging they practice biblical stewardship in their personal and professional lives and by giving regularly in proportion to their income.
Biblical Principles
- Spend less than you make
- Be prudent with debt
- Build liquidity
- Set long-term goals
- Act like a manager, not an owner
- Give generously
